The Jewish people need to relearn a painful and essential lesson—that they are responsible for their own protection.
By Melanie Phillips, JNS
Ukraine’s stunning attack on Russia last Sunday, in which 117 drones burst out of vehicles parked near Russian airbases to wipe out one-third of the country’s strategic cruise missile carriers, has caused widespread amazement and admiration.
The audacious operation calls instantly to mind some of the most spectacular coups of Israel’s Mossad, such as last year’s exploding Hezbollah pagers and the daring 2018 heist of 100,000 documents from Iran’s nuclear archive in Tehran.
Ukraine’s drone attack exhibited the same kind of brilliance, brio and sheer chutzpah. There was a further important characteristic that it shared with Israel.
Kyiv was driven to this act of desperate daring because it understands that it is alone. Europe may have provided it with weapons, but it’s not going to provide what Ukraine needs to win the war.
As for America, President Donald Trump is not only refusing to provide the means to defeat Russia but has been bullying Ukraine effectively to surrender and is persistently cozying up to Russia’s president, Vladimir Putin. Even now, having declared his exasperation at Putin’s continued belligerence and having been told by the Russian leader that he will retaliate strongly for the drone attack, Trump is treating Putin as a valuable ally who will help negotiate a deal with Iran.
The idea that a cynical tyrant intent on spreading his power round the world should be negotiating a deal with genocidal fanatics at war with the West and intent upon exterminating Israel should chill the heart.
The big question is how Trump will react when he realizes that he is facing two utterly intractable foes in both Moscow and Tehran. Israel is holding its breath that Trump will help it totally destroy Iran’s nuclear program.
Without the United States, it’s said that Israel can inflict significant damage on that program but can’t destroy it entirely. Nevertheless, if Trump walks away, Israel says it will act against Iran alone.
For the longer term, Israel is now preparing to wean itself off U.S. military aid. It’s realized its mistake in having become dangerously complacent about American support. It’s relearning the ancient lesson the Jewish people must teach itself—that it’s a lethal illusion to imagine that it can afford to rely on anyone else.
For their part, Diaspora Jews are now starting to understand that their acceptance into Western countries, which for decades they had taken for granted, is also a mirage.

This week, the United States vetoed a U.N. Security Council resolution calling for an “immediate, unconditional and permanent ceasefire” between Israel and Hamas.
Dorothy Shea, the acting U.S. Ambassador to the United Nations, told the council that America wouldn’t support any measure that failed to condemn Hamas and didn’t call for it to disarm and leave Gaza. The resolution, she said, would undermine diplomatic efforts to reach a ceasefire and would embolden Hamas.
All too true. Yet along with all the other council members, the United Kingdom voted in favor of the resolution. British Ambassador Barbara Woodward denounced Israel’s conduct of the war as “unjustifiable, disproportionate and counterproductive.”
“Palestinians, desperate to feed their families, have been killed as they try to reach the very few aid sites that have been permitted by Israel. This is inhumane,” she said.
But her claims were untrue. Worse came in a debate in Britain’s House of Commons, where the mendacious venom against Israel was off the charts.
The prime minister, Sir Keir Starmer, called Israel’s conduct “appalling” and “intolerable.” The junior Foreign Office minister, Hamish Falconer, said the government was “appalled by repeated reports of mass casualty incidents in which Palestinians have been killed when trying to access aid sites in Gaza.”
